The revolving "ice tunnel" in the aliens' mountain base was a then new attraction at the Universal Studios Tour. However, the attraction had a tram running through the tunnel. When the producers of The Six Million Dollar Man filmed sequences there for this episode, the tram-rails used on the Universal Tour ride were conspicuously covered with cloth and a forced-perspective miniature was placed at the far end of the tunnel, which is especially visible as Bigfoot stands before it.
